Output c91e2aa5f4586d856644a56877606332947c348f46836d57f6a91588fa32d22b:11

value
671685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c4c5d593e7af1c089b816114faf2bc8d0f76e6 OP_EQUAL
address
3LdbXGNQKAm7WJcJ3g1urKbJKeGCkGDSws
transaction
c91e2aa5f4586d856644a56877606332947c348f46836d57f6a91588fa32d22b